Muar Food Trip
When you come to Muar, you must come to their Muar Gljtton Street to hunt their street food! But with this Covid-19 pandemic, all the food hawkers are move-in the shop and would not be allowed to locate at the roadside.
In Muar Gljtton Street, you can found a lot of Muar local food like otak-otak, fried egg with oyster, Teo Chew Kuih, and others.
Teo Chew Kuih the store has started over 50 years and now with the third generation. Their TeoChew Kuih is mainly salty and sweet. They use green beans to make the sweet kuih and Cha Shao will be salty kuih.

This Hainanese curry chicken is located in the Lushan Teahouse, at the end of Glutton Street. There are big signs hanging outside, so don’t be afraid to find it! The Hainanese curry rice here is characterized by combining curry sauce and marinade。 The owner also added salted fish to the rice, so it tastes changeable, a bit salty, and slightly spicy and sweet. The Hainanese curry chicken with curry and marinade combined with rice is a perfect match!

This fried oyster also one of my favorite in this glutton street. some of the fried oyster store they put a lot of potato flour, but this hawker is different. you can taste the strong egg flavor and also their fresh juicy oyster. with their special chili sauce, you will be surprised.
